The Importance of Transparency and User Trust in Online Betting
As the industry matures, consumers increasingly scrutinise platform operations. Trust is built through clear information, regulatory compliance, and robust security features. For instance, jurisdictions such as Ontario (with its recent legalization of online gambling) impose strict standards to protect players, emphasizing the importance of platform transparency and fair play.
In this context, understanding how platforms operate is crucial for informed consumer decisions. This entails not only knowing the odds or payout mechanisms but also understanding the underlying technology and regulatory compliance measures.
Technology and User Engagement in Betting Platforms
Modern betting platforms utilize advanced algorithms, secure payment gateways, and personalised interfaces to cater to different user preferences. Many integrate features such as live betting, real-time odds updates, and responsible gambling tools, which are vital for maintaining user engagement and trust.
Some platforms adopt innovative features such as AI-driven customer support chatbots or data analytics to offer tailored betting options, thereby enhancing user satisfaction and platform loyalty.

The Significance of Reliable Information Sources
| Aspect | Details | Implications for Users |
|---|---|---|
| Regulatory Compliance | Adheres to provincial and national laws ensuring fair play and security. | Builds credibility and reduces risks of fraud or account suspension. |
| Security Protocols | Uses encryption, secure payment methods, and fraud detection systems. | Protects user data and financial transactions, ensuring trustworthiness. |
| Operational Transparency | Provides clear information about odds, payout mechanisms, and rules. | Empowers users to make informed betting decisions. |
| Customer Support & Education | Offers accessible support channels and educational resources. | Facilitates understanding of platform operations and responsible gaming. |
